An Alternative to Preschool Education Settings: A Sample Project

Öz This is a qualitative study which investigates the characteristics of an ideal preschool setting. The study has recourse to personal observations as well as projects of ideal preschool education institutions conducted by undergraduate students at the Department of Preschool Education, Faculty of Educational Sciences, Ankara University. Besides the design of original preschool education institution, the study uses the data obtained from interviews with 18 preschool teachers and 8 directors of preschool education institutions. The data from these interviews were summarized and interpreted by descriptive analysis. Visual elements were used to define the preschool institutions, designed for the purpose of this present project, and its interior and exterior settings, classroom environment, living and playing areas, activity corners, garden and position and characteristics of other components. An architectural drawing is used as well. In the light of all above mentioned findings, the study proposes the design of a sample preschool education institution.
